It's also a function of position. Teuhema was good enough to win the starting LG spot, but just because Weathersby subbed in for him doesn't necessarily have anything to do with the quality of the other players. Some of them may not be in consideration for the LG spot and are backups for RG, RT, etc...

A lot of O Linemen don't come into their own until their 2nd or 3rd (if a redshirt) year in a program. These guys will hone their technique another year, and the cream will rise to the top. We will likely lose 2, possibly even 3 guys this year to the draft, so they won't have to wait long.
